44、otocol TIP Terminating Identification Presentation TIR Terminating Identification Restriction UE User Equipment XML Extensible Markup Language 4 Terminating Identification Presentation (TIP) and Terminating Identification Restriction (TIR) 4.1 Introduction The Terminating Identification Presentation

45、 (TIP) service provides the originating party with the possibility of receiving identity information in order to identify the terminating party. The network shall deliver the Terminating Identity to the originating party on communication acceptance regardless of the terminal capability to handle the

46、 information. The Terminating Identification Restriction (TIR) is a service offered to the connected party which enables the connected party to prevent presentation of the terminating identity information to originating party. 4.2 Description 4.2.1 General description The Terminating Identification

47、Presentation (TIP) service provides the originating party with the possibility of receiving trusted information in order to identify the terminating party. The Terminating Identification Restriction (TIR) is a service offered to the terminating party which enables the terminating party to prevent pr

48、esentation of the terminating identity information to originating party. ETSI ETSI TS 124 608 V13.0.0 (2016-01)93GPP TS 24.608 version 13.0.0 Release 134.3 Operational requirements 4.3.1 Provision/withdrawal 4.3.1.1 TIP provision/withdrawal The TIP service may be provided after prior arrangement wit

49、h the service provider or be generally available. The TIP service shall be withdrawn at the subscribers request or for administrative reasons. As a general operator policy a special arrangement may exist on a per subscriber basis or on a general behaviour basis whereby the terminating users identity information intended to be transparently transported by the network is not screened by the network. 4.3.1.2 TIR provision/withdrawal The TIR service, temporary mode, may be provided on a
